Transferring disentangled representations: bridging the gap between synthetic and real images

构建有意义且高效的表征以分离数据生成机制的本质结构,在表征学习中至关重要。然而,由于生成因素相关、分辨率差异及真实标签获取受限,解耦表征学习在真实图像上的潜力尚未充分发挥。针对后者,本文探讨利用合成数据学习通用解耦表征并应用于真实数据的可行性,分析微调的影响以及解耦性质在迁移中的保留情况。我们进行了广泛的实证研究,并提出一种新的可解释干预度量指标,用于评估表征中因子编码的质量。结果表明,从合成数据到真实数据的解耦表示迁移是可行且有效的。

Developing meaningful and efficient representations that separate the fundamental structure of the data generation mechanism is crucial in representation learning. However, Disentangled Representation Learning has not fully shown its potential on real images, because of correlated generative factors, their resolution and limited access to ground truth labels. Specifically on the latter, we investigate the possibility of leveraging synthetic data to learn general-purpose disentangled representations applicable to real data, discussing the effect of fine-tuning and what properties of disentanglement are preserved after the transfer. We provide an extensive empirical study to address these issues. In addition, we propose a new interpretable intervention-based metric, to measure the quality of factors encoding in the representation. Our results indicate that some level of disentanglement, transferring a representation from synthetic to real data, is possible and effective.
